  • Rajnigandha celebrates brand success in new campaign

    By A Correspondent

     

    Rajnigandha has launched a new campaign captioned “KuchKarAisa, Duniya Banna ChaheTereJaisa”.The new campaign reinforces and strengthens the key concept of success which has always underlined brand messaging for Rajnigandha. The latest campaign underlines the fact that the ultimate accolade is the one where success itself inspires others to reach new heights. The film focuses on successful protagonists in various fields of literature, music, sports, business and architecture, who with their sheer brilliance and recognitionhave become a source of inspiration to others.

     

    Commenting on the campaign, Prasoon Joshi, Chairman, Asia Pacific; CEO & Chief Creative Officer, McCann Worldgroup India, said, “Rajnigandha as a brand was always about evolving to the next level. The campaign back in 2004 revolved around the success of the protagonist, while keeping Indian pride and values in mind. The second phase took the key thought of success to the next level; where it wasn’t only about achieving success but just as important to help and enable the success of those around you. Finally, the latest campaign is about inspiration – where the protagonist, instead of becoming an object of envy, has risen to inspire those around him.”

     

    Rajeev Jain, Associate VP, Marketing, DS Group, added“Through this campaign, we want young India to get motivated by their Idols and try to be like them. Rajnigandha has always been a symbol of success, aspiration, stature and a perfect companion for the successful people for last three decades. It will now redefine the leadership aspect as well. The new theme is a paradigm shift to a new class of successful Indians who inspire, as they reach the pinnacle of success.”

     

    The campaign embarks by releasing TVC followed by digital, outdoor and below the line (BTL) and POS medium.

     

  • Rajnigandha unveils new TVC

    By A Correspondent

     

    Rajnigandha has launched a new TVC campaign for Rajnigandha Pan Masala with a fresh slogan -“Yunhi Nahin Main, Rajnigandha Ban Jaata Hun”. The new TVC illustrates the journey of the brand’s conviction, passion, expertise, consistency, uncompromising approach and hard work towards delivering the most premium experience through every pack of Rajnigandha Pan Masala.

     

    Conceptualized by McCann, the new TVC has been directed by Richard de Cunha under the banner of Bang Bang Films. The film showcases the arduous journey and passion that the Rajnigandha endures to source the best of ingredients for the product from diverse geographies.

     

    Rajeev Jain, Associate Vice President, Marketing, Dharampal Satyapal Ltd. said, “Rajnigandha, premium pan masala is perfect blend of precious ingredients and aromatic flavors including Betelnut, Catechu, Lime, Cardamom seeds, Clove, exotic Ruh Kewda, Ruh Gulab and premium Sandalwood oil. The new TVC is an effort to refresh the bond with our consumers and share the glorious journey which brings that unique, consistent taste to Pan Masala connoisseurs for decades.”

     

    Sanjay Nayak, President, McCann World Group, further added, “The idea here is to communicate the love, passion, sincerity and perfection that goes behind making Rajnigandha.”

     

  • McCann gets Rajnigandha to the stadium

    By A Correspondent

     

    Dharampal Satyapal (DS) Group has launched a new campaign captioned Stadium for its mouth freshener brand Rajnigandha. The new campaign will mark a giant leap in the underlying perception and motive of the brand with the new punch line “Munh Mein Rajnigandha Dil Mein Hai Duniya”. The key message of the campaign is “Success that makes a difference evokes admiration”. The campaign created by McCann Erickson, embarks by releasing TVC followed by digital, outdoor, and below the line (BTL) and POS medium.

     

    Commenting on the campaign, Rajeev Jain, Sr General Manager, Marketing, said, “Rajnigandha has always been a symbol of success, aspiration, stature and a perfect companion for the successful people for last three decades; it will now redefine the leadership aspect as well. The new punchline “Munh Mein Rajnigandha Dil Mein Hai Duniya” is a paradigm shift to a new benevolent and successful India.”

     

    While the earlier Rajnigandha campaign focused more on the success, the new Rajnigandha campaign has a more compassionate, humane approach. The campaign talks about an evolved person who is an equal contributor to the success of his fellow men. The protagonist of the commercial is shown as a successful business magnate, who not only has strong business acumen; but is also concerned for the well-being of society at large.

     

    The TVC shows with three investors presenting a blueprint to a young businessman in a field. This is followed by a well-heeled businessman with a calm and serene air around him, who steps out of a Limousine. The elder brother surveys the land and sees few kids playing cricket. The younger brother then excitedly blurts his business plan to create India’s biggest mega mall consisting of theme parks, amusement grounds and 6 multiplexes on that land. We see that the batsman hits the ball and it strikes the car. The elder brother throws back the ball to the kids and says “Yahan stadium banna chahiye”. One of the investors mutters under his breath ‘Charity ke bare main soch rahe hain’. Elder brother responds “Kal ki soch rahe hain”. He opens a pack of Rajnigandha, pops in a spoonful and replies “kabhi toh aisa khwab dekhiye, jismain hazaro khwab shamil ho”. Followed by this sequence is a newsperson making an announcement ‘GR Enterprises ke international stadium ne iss sheher ke logon main garv ki bhaavna aur sports culture ko adbhutt badaava diya hai’.
